Theory Test
The part that tests your theory during your driving lessons in Grimsby is the first step towards passing your practical test. The theory test is split into two parts of multiple choice and the hazard perception part. The hazard perception test requires you to watch a series of video clips and click when you notice a developing hazard. These videos feature road scenes like those you've seen during your Driving Lessons; click through the following website, in Grimsby. This part of the test must be passed with scores of at least 43 points out of 50.
You can practice for the hazard perception section of the test on your own or with the help of a person who has passed their theory exam. You can also make use of a website such as Theory Test Pro to practice your ability to recognize hazards. The site offers practice questions and videos that will help you prepare for the test in theory.

Practical Test
The test portion of driving lessons Grimsby is a chance to demonstrate your ability to drive on your own. The examiner will ask you questions on anything from road safety in general to shifting gears. You are required to perform a reversing maneuver and possibly an emergency halt. The test will take between 35 and 40 minutes.

Nervousness
Even if you're an experienced driver, it's common to feel anxious when you first take the steering wheel. The good news is that there are ways to ease the anxiety and stress you might feel, so it doesn't derail your progress.
You should first speak to your instructor. This will enable them to comprehend what you need and they'll be able offer advice or techniques that could be beneficial to you. They should also let you know what the first lesson will be like so that you'll have an idea of what to expect.
The right instructor for your driving can make a huge difference to your experience and confidence. Find a driver who is patient, friendly and supportive. You can even ask for suggestions from family members or friends members who have taken driving lessons. This will help you find an instructor that is the right fit to your needs and anxiety level.
It is important to be prepared for your classes However, don't over-plan. If you're feeling stressed or overwhelmed, you won't be able to focus on the task at hand. It's also a good idea to wear comfortable clothing, and remember to bring your driving licence with you, as your instructor will need to see it prior to beginning your lesson.
You'll probably start your lessons on quiet, residential roads before moving onto busier areas as you become more confident. You'll come across a variety junctions and traffic signals, roundabouts, and no-entry signs along the way. You'll get more comfortable with them as you learn and practice.
